Description

Based on the authors' earlier paper, the Sommerfeld parameters in the BBK wave function are further modified in asymmetric geometry. The influence of the Sommerfeld parameters on the triple differential cross sections is considered. The triple differential cross sections for electron impact ionization of atomic hydrogen at low incident energies in asymmetric geometry are calculated by use of the modified Sommerfeld parameters. The results were compared with those of the earlier paper and the theoretical results of the convergent close-coupling method. It was found that the present results give a better description for the experimental data
